The correct answer is:
**D) The process by which new minerals form from existing minerals as a result of elevated temperature or pressure.**
Metamorphism refers to the changes in mineralogy and texture that occur in rocks due to increased temperature, pressure, or chemically active fluids, typically occurring deep within the Earth's crust.
